Methodology Behind Gallup Trump Polls
Gallup conducts ongoing political polling with standardized procedures to ensure comparability over time. For Trump-related measurement, they typically use national random samples drawn from landline and cellphone frames, along with address-based sampling where possible. Surveys are weighted to match U.S. Census benchmarks on demographics, region, and other key variables. Detailed methodology notes, including sample size and margin of error, are published with each release. This rigorous process supports longitudinal trend analysis and credible comparisons.
Sampling and Data Collection
Gallup’s samples are selected to reflect the U.S. adult population, with quotas used to align with demographic targets. Interviews are conducted via web, phone, and mail depending on survey design. This mixed-mode strategy helps reach diverse populations and reduce coverage bias. Real-time weighting adjusts for nonresponse and other imbalances. Gallup also reports on key quality indicators, including response rates and representation metrics, to increase transparency.

Key Metrics and How to Read Them
When reviewing Gallup Trump polls, focus on sample size, margin of error, and confidence level first. Look at the question wording, as subtle changes can move results. Examine subgroup data, including party, age, gender, region, and education, to uncover patterns. Compare results across time windows rather than isolating single days or point estimates. Treat each release as one data point in a longer evidence chain.
| Attribute | Verified Detail | Source Type |
|---|---|---|
| Typical Sample Size | Approximately 1,000 to 2,000 U.S. adults per major survey | Methodology documentation |
| Margin of Error | Generally ±3 to ±4 percentage points at the 95% confidence level for key national estimates | Gallup standard reporting |
| Key Trend Metrics | Multiweek approval trends, subgroup shifts, partisan gaps | Gallup trend analysis reports |
| Data Longevity | Multiyear historical archives supporting longitudinal analysis | Gallup analytics archive |

Common Misinterpretations and How to Avoid Them
Readers sometimes mistake a single poll snapshot for a definitive truth, or assume small day-to-day changes reflect major swings. Question wording, timing relative to events, and sample selection can all influence results. Another risk is treating nonrepresentative online panels or convenience samples as equivalent to Gallup’s probability-based studies. Avoid conflating media coverage of polls with the underlying data quality. Responsible interpretation requires understanding uncertainty, question design, and historical baselines.
